Robotics and AI combine several technology disciplines, so students can potentially explore different career directions depending on the skills they develop. Possible areas include robotics engineering, automation, artificial intelligence, computer vision, embedded systems, autonomous systems, machine learning, industrial automation, and robotics software development. The exact career path depends heavily on specialization. A student interested in robotic hardware may focus more on sensors, embedded systems, control systems, and electronics. Someone interested in intelligent software may concentrate on Python, machine learning, computer vision, and AI algorithms. Projects and internships can help students understand which area suits them best.
